On 01/11/2016 10:12 AM, lists at openmailbox.org wrote:
> Emacs (not MicroEmacs which is available on the web)

As we learned the other day, you  - ahem I - shouldn't work with VAXes
any more. So this is for entertainment, only:

$ @[-.emacs212_3]configure --with-tcpip=NO --with-x=NO
--WITH-X-TOOLKIT=NO --prefix=bld_root:[LOCAL]
--startupdir=bld_root:[LOCAL.STAR
TUP]
$ ...
$ @BLD_ROOT:[LOCAL.STARTUP]GNU_STARTUP EMACS-21.2 NOLOGICALS
%GNU_STARTUP-I-SETTING_UP,  setting up Emacs version 21.2
$
$ define term vt100
$ runemacs

Interesting, the source code directory indicates version 21.2.3 but
emacs itself prints 21.2.1.

This is based on the emacs21_2.zip from the 8.0 freeware cd. There are a
couple of changes to let emacs make a computer slow. It looks like that
code was never built or tested on VAXes. Also, this VAX is a simh and I
use the console, OPA0:, set to a reasonable baud rate. I can't get it to
work when logged in via telnet to port 60123, which is a simh DZ device,
aka TTA0:. The process hangs in LEF with two busy channels to TTA0:. I
have/had other problems with that device: "-SYSTEM-W-DATAOVERUN, data
overrun" when I type very fast, aka do a cut and paste. So, it's not yet
production quality, but for hobbyists ...
